The Advance Tabco 6-1-24 Square Corner Scullery Sink is a commercial-grade, single-compartment kitchen sink designed for high-performance foodservice environments. Crafted from 16-gauge 300 series stainless steel, it offers excellent durability and corrosion resistance. The sink measures 24 inches wide by 21 inches front to back, with a depth of 14 inches, making it suitable for washing large cookware, prep tools, and ingredients efficiently. Its features include an 8-inch splash height backsplash and a 1-1/2 inch IPS waste drain basket, facilitating effective drainage and sanitation. With galvanized legs and plastic bullet feet, this unit ensures stability and ease of maintenance, ideal for busy restaurant, cafeteria, or institutional kitchens seeking reliable, hygienic, and space-efficient solutions.

The Advance Tabco 6-1-24 features a straightforward design tailored for demanding foodservice applications. It operates with standard plumbing fixtures connected via a 1-1/2 inch IPS waste drain basket and is constructed from 16 gauge 300 series stainless steel, offering excellent corrosion resistance and durability. The overall dimensions include a width of 24 inches, a front-to-back depth of 21 inches, and a basin depth of 14 inches, accommodating large utensils and cookware. Its height of 41 inches accounts for the splash height backsplash, ensuring water containment and sanitation. The unit weighs approximately 53 lbs, with galvanized legs equipped with plastic bullet feet for stability. It requires no electrical connections and is easy to disassemble for cleaning and maintenance.
